5 - PROJECT SCOPE MANAGEMENT






                      5.6.1 control Scope: Inputs



                      5.6.1.1 Project Management Plan

                         Described in Section 4.2.3.1. The following information from the project management plan is used to control
                      scope:
                            •   Scope baseline. The scope baseline is compared to actual results to determine if a change, corrective
                              action, or preventive action is necessary.

                            •   Scope management plan. Sections from the scope management plan describe how the project scope
                              will be monitored and controlled.
                            •   change management plan. The change management plan defines the process for managing change
                              on the project.
                            •   configuration management plan. The configuration management plan defines those items that are
                              configurable, those items that require formal change control, and the process for controlling changes to
                              such items.
                            •   requirements management plan. This plan is a component of the project management plan and
                              describes how the project requirements will be analyzed, documented, and managed.


                      5.6.1.2 requirements documentation

                         Described in Section 5.2.3.1. Requirements should be unambiguous (measurable and testable), traceable,
                      complete, consistent, and acceptable to key stakeholders. Well-documented requirements make it easier to detect
                      any deviation in the scope agreed for the project or product.


                      5.6.1.3 requirements traceability Matrix

                         Described in Section 5.2.3.2. The requirements traceability matrix helps to detect the impact of any change or
                      deviation from the scope baseline on the project objectives.
